Factors Influencing Costs
- Size of the Area: Larger areas typically cost more to clear due to the increased labor and equipment required.
- Density of Vegetation: Heavily wooded or overgrown areas require more time and resources to clear.
- Type of Vegetation: Different types of trees and plants can affect the cost. For example, hardwood trees are generally more expensive to remove than softwood trees.
- Accessibility: Easily accessible areas are cheaper to clear compared to those that are difficult to reach.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ations and the need for permits can add to the overall cost.
- Equipment Required: Specialized equipment may be needed for certain tasks, increasing the cost.
- Disposal of Debris: The method of debris disposal, whether it is hauling away or chipping on-site, can impact the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Jeffersonville, IN) |
---|---|
Land Clearing (per acre) |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Tree Removal (per tree) | $200 - $700 |
Stump Grinding (per stump) | $100 - $400 |
Brush Removal (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Debris Hauling (per load) | $200 - $500 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$75 - $150 |
